My personal observation, having homeschooled my junior and senior year, the level of wasted time (i.e. not adding value) at public school is incredible.

While it wouldn’t work at all age levels, the program I used was incredibly flexible and really encouraged curiosity.

This isn’t to say I didn’t benefit from attending public schools. There were programs and experiences there that would be difficult to impossible to replicate.

However, overall, I’d guess that at least 50% of time in public schooling is baby sitting and crowd control.
